
WKCTC announces summer 2026 course offerings
West Kentucky Community & Technical College announced its summer 2026 course offerings, providing students with a wide range of academic and technical classes designed to meet diverse educational and workforce goals. Programs range from nursing and biological sciences to business, welding and truck driving, with courses beginning in May, June and July.
